I've STFA, seen sample photos and read write-ups for placing the unit behind the grille area. I'd like to attach it in a different location since (a) I'm worried that the jarring caused by opening an closing of the hood might affect the transponder's position if it is placed in behind the main grille and (b) my license plate sits very low on my RS4 bumper, so I'd like to get the transponder as close to the plate and main bumper cover facia as possible.
Here's a picture of where I'm thinking of installing the single transponder (I need to save up more $$$ before I can get a second transponder). I will likely pick the area highlighted in red on the driver's side as my first option. ![]() I noticed that there aren't too many places behind the lower grille area where I can attach the transponder's brackets, since the RS4 bumper mounting areas behind the lower grill section are different from the stock bumper. If any of you have the RS4 bumper and have done a similar type of install please offer advice. TIA.
